linux系统命令设置IP地址
-
要在Linux系统中设置IP地址,可以通过以下步骤进行。
1. 打开终端:
进入Linux系统后,打开终端,可以通过快捷键Ctrl+Alt+T来快速打开终端。2. 查看当前网络配置:
在终端中输入以下命令,查看当前网络配置信息:
“`
ifconfig
“`3. 修改网络配置文件:
打开网络配置文件,可以使用以下命令:
“`
sudo vi /etc/network/interfaces
“`4. 设置静态IP地址:
在打开的配置文件中,找到对应网卡的配置,如eth0,将配置改为静态IP地址:
“`
iface eth0 inet static
address
netmask <子网掩码>
gateway <网关地址>
“`其中,
是要设置的IP地址,<子网掩码>是网络的子网掩码,<网关地址>是网络的网关地址。 5. 保存并关闭文件:
在Vi编辑器中,按下Esc键,输入:wq并按下Enter键,保存并关闭文件。6. 重新启动网络服务:
在终端中输入以下命令,以应用新的IP地址配置:
“`
sudo systemctl restart networking
“`7. 验证IP地址是否设置成功:
使用ifconfig命令再次查看网络配置信息,确认IP地址是否已成功修改。通过以上步骤,你可以在Linux系统中成功设置IP地址。请注意,这些步骤可能因不同的Linux发行版和版本而略有差异,但总体思路是相同的。
2年前 -
在Linux系统中,可以使用以下命令来设置IP地址:
1. ifconfig命令:ifconfig命令用于配置网络接口的IP地址、MAC地址等信息。使用ifconfig命令可以添加、修改和删除网络接口的IP地址。例如,要将网卡eth0的IP地址设置为192.168.1.100,可以使用以下命令:
“`
ifconfig eth0 192.168.1.100
“`如果要指定子网掩码,可以使用netmask参数,如下所示:
“`
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
“`2. ip命令:ip命令是用于配置和管理网络接口的强大工具。使用ip命令可以设置IP地址、子网掩码、网关等参数。例如,要将网卡eth0的IP地址设置为192.168.1.100,可以使用以下命令:
“`
ip address add 192.168.1.100/24 dev eth0
“`如果要设置默认网关,可以使用以下命令:
“`
ip route add default via 192.168.1.1
“`3. nmcli命令:nmcli命令是NetworkManager的命令行工具,用于配置和管理网络连接。如果你的Linux系统使用NetworkManager进行网络管理,可以使用nmcli命令来设置IP地址。例如,要将网卡eth0的IP地址设置为192.168.1.100,可以使用以下命令:
“`
nmcli con modify eth0 ipv4.addresses 192.168.1.100/24
“`如果要设置默认网关,可以使用以下命令:
“`
nmcli con modify eth0 ipv4.gateway 192.168.1.1
“`4. sysctl命令:sysctl命令用于配置内核参数。要设置永久IP地址,可以修改/sys/class/net/
/address文件。例如,要将网卡eth0的IP地址设置为192.168.1.100,可以使用以下命令: “`
echo “192.168.1.100” > /sys/class/net/eth0/address
“`如果要设置子网掩码,可以修改/sys/class/net/
/netmask文件。 5. 配置文件:另一种设置IP地址的方法是通过编辑配置文件来进行。在大多数Linux发行版中,网络接口的配置文件位于/etc/network/interfaces。可以编辑该文件,添加或修改相应的参数。例如,要将网卡eth0的IP地址设置为192.168.1.100,可以使用以下命令:
“`
vi /etc/network/interfaces
“`并在文件中添加如下行:
“`
iface eth0 inet static
address 192.168.1.100
netmask 255.255.255.0
“`完成后,保存文件并重启网络服务以使更改生效。
以上是在Linux系统中设置IP地址的几种常用方法。根据实际情况选择合适的方法来配置网络接口的IP地址。
2年前 -
Linux系统中设置IP地址可以通过命令行进行操作,具体流程如下:
1. 查看当前网络接口:使用`ifconfig`命令查看当前系统中的网络接口,该命令会列出所有网络接口的信息。
2. 修改网络接口配置文件:使用文本编辑器(如vi)打开 networking 配置文件。
“`shell
sudo vi /etc/network/interfaces
“`在该文件中,可以找到与网络接口相关的配置信息,如`eth0`。
3. 配置静态IP地址:在网络接口配置文件中,找到需要设置IP地址的网络接口,添加以下信息:
“`shell
auto eth0
iface eth0 inet static
address 192.168.1.100 # 设置静态IP地址
netmask 255.255.255.0 # 设置子网掩码
gateway 192.168.1.1 # 设置网关
dns-nameservers 8.8.8.8 # 设置DNS服务器
“`根据实际情况修改 IP 地址、子网掩码、网关和 DNS 服务器地址。
4. 重启网络服务:使用以下命令重启网络服务以应用新的IP地址配置。
“`shell
sudo systemctl restart networking
“`5. 验证IP地址设置:使用`ifconfig`命令查看网络接口的信息,确保IP地址已经成功更改。
以上就是在Linux系统中通过命令行设置IP地址的具体步骤。需要注意的是,不同Linux发行版可能有略微不同的命令和配置文件路径,所以在实际操作中需根据具体情况进行调整。
2年前